BGP Timers

Written by Rene Molenaar on . Posted in BGP

Scenario:

You are a film producer and parttime network engineer. You use BGP to connect two sites to each other but you feel things are a little slow. Let's see if you can tune up some of those BGP timers.

Goal:

  • All IP addresses have been preconfigured for you.
  • Configure EBGP between AS 1 and AS 2.
  • The BGP scanner should run every 30 seconds on both routers.
  • Ensure both routers don't wait till the next BGP advertisement-interval but send updates immediately.
  • When there is no activity after 15 seconds the BGP peering should be dropped.
